Java生成"年月日"+流水号

 1     private final static String FORMAT_CODE = "0000";
 2     private final static String PRE_CODE = "BM";
 3     @Test
 4     public void FormatCode() {
 5         int count = 1; // 流水号
 6         DecimalFormat dft = new DecimalFormat(FORMAT_CODE);
 7         String code = dft.format(count); // 格式化为四位流水号 code: 0001
 8         SimpleDateFormat sdf = new SimpleDateFormat("yyyyMMdd");
 9         String date = sdf.format(new Date()); // 格式化日期 date: 20200724
10         String codeEnd = PRE_CODE + date + code;
11         System.out.println(codeEnd);
12     }

输出结果为 : BM202007240001

posted @ 2020-07-24 15:18  竹秋千道  阅读(4883)  评论(0编辑  收藏  举报